- Day 4
Korčula
Morning includes a cruise with a swimming stop before you reach Korčula, believed to be Marco Polo's birthplace. A guided tour takes you through medieval streets arranged in a distinctive fishbone pattern that provides natural shade and catches sea breezes. Later, you'll have options for dinner out at local restaurants and bars, or join an optional excursion to a nearby village for traditional Dalmatian food.

- Day 5
Vis
You're heading to Vis, an island that was closed to visitors during its time as a Yugoslav military base but now welcomes travelers with its unspoiled character. Optional tours are available if you want to explore the local culture, natural landscape, and regional wines, or you can explore on your own.

- Day 9
Zagreb
The morning starts with a walking tour of Plitvice Lakes National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site with 16 turquoise lakes connected by waterfalls and ringed by thick forest. In the afternoon, you'll drive to Zagreb, Croatia's bustling capital city.
